Overview

This officially licensed board book features Elvira, Mistress of the Dark, as she introduces her classic monster friends to littlest readers and adult horror movie fans. ""Well, hello there, darlings! Tonight we are going to lean about some of my favorite monsters."" Little readers will enjoy some spooky fun with little Elvira as they learn about aliens, blob monsters, vampires, zombies, and more in this adorable officially licensed early concept board book.

Author Information

Cassandra Peterson (aka Elvira) was born in Manhattan, Kansas, and raised in Colorado Springs, Colorado. At age 17, she began performing as a showgirl at the Dunes Hotel in Las Vegas, then traveled to Europe where she pursued a career as a singer and actor. Upon returning to the states, Peterson toured America as star of her own musical-comedy show, Mama's Boys. She eventually settled in Hollywood, where she spent four years with L.A.'s foremost improvisational comedy group, The Groundlings. In 1981, she auditioned for the part of ""horror hostess"" on a local Los Angeles station. That show, Movie Macabre, and her newly created character, Elvira, became an overnight sensation and gained national syndication. Peterson also co-wrote, produced, and starred in two feature length films: Elvira, Mistress of the Dark and Elvira's Haunted Hills. She has spent four decades solidifying her unique brand and building it into an internationally recognized pop culture icon synonymous with Halloween and the horror genre. Pintachan has been an illustrator for more than a decade, working with a variety of clients all over the world. He loves doo-wop, psych-pop, 70s disco, 50s rock 'n roll, and Motown. He lives in Gijon, Spain, with his family.
